• synecdoche - a figure of speech in which a part is used for the whole or the whole for a part; the special for the general or the general for the special/ex: a Croseus for a rich man
  • frump - a person who is dowdy, drab, and unattractive/ a dull, old fashioned person
  • pullulate - spread, produce rapidly/exist abundantly/send forth buds, sprouts; germinate
